Hardwood flooring installation by floor area: Bloomington vs South Bend
Hardwood is priced per square foot installed — roughly $6–$25/sq ft depending on the wood and labor. Measure the rooms you're covering; bigger jobs cost more total but often less per square foot.
| Size | Bloomington | South Bend |
|---|---|---|
| 200 sq ft (small room) | $1,550–$4,300 | $1,500–$4,300 |
| 500 sq ft (large room) | $3,350–$8,600 | $3,350–$8,550 |
| 1,000 sq ft (main floor) | $5,750–$14,350 | $5,700–$14,300 |
| 1,500+ sq ft (whole home) | $8,600–$21,100 | $8,550–$20,950 |

How should you budget a flooring project?
A flooring budget is really two budgets — the material on top and the subfloor work underneath. Our editors break down the trade-offs.
The material-value case
Laminate and luxury vinyl deliver a hardwood look for a fraction of the price and handle moisture better — the value pick for busy homes and tight budgets.
The longevity case
Hardwood carries a higher sticker, but a solid plank sands and refinishes several times across its life and it lifts what the house sells for. For owners planning to stay, spreading that cost over decades makes the premium reasonable.
The hidden-cost case
What blows up a flooring budget is rarely the flooring — it's the plywood or slab beneath it. Get leveling, old-floor removal and haul-away written into the bid, because a quote that skips them grows the moment the crew pulls up the first row.
Traffic and time in the house point to the right material; the subfloor points to the right budget. Leave that second line off your estimate and the cheapest planks you could find end up costing the most.
